https://www.twincities.com/2025/07/06/new-artists-at-pine-needles-include-an-illustrator-a-mapmaker-and-a-storyteller/The Australian Design Centre in Darlinghurst has lost federal and state funding, leaving it with a $200,000 deficit. The centre, which supports artisans and designers since 1964, is now facing financial uncertainty after being recommended for funding by peer assessors but missing out on the four-year operational grant. Director Lisa Cahill described the situation as "do or die," urging its 30,000 social media followers to donate $100 each to keep the centre afloat.

The school has tasked its art students with this project for almost 20 years, and recent exhibitions showcased 15 new artworks, including pieces depicting the horrors of the blast, such as a girl surrounded by flames and a boy's mother comforting him after his father died from burns. The students relied on their imagination and historical documents to create these powerful works, which aim to convey the emotional struggles of those who survived the bombing.

Born Martin Fulterman in Brooklyn, New York, he attended Juilliard School. Snow is best known for his work on The X Files, composing its iconic theme and over 200 episodes of the show, as well as two feature films. He received 15 Emmy nominations throughout his career.
